Now I am trying 90% isopropyl alcohol and that does seem to work at some level. After an hour soaking, thin areas of the paint on the Walthers model started to come off, not lifting in sheets, but melting away slowly. On the back of the molded parts most is gone. But the 'finished' side of parts, such as the underframe, seem to have substantially more paint applied. Perhaps to make sure the color coverage is opaque and saturated to the eye.
